Classic Advent wreath with moss
As darkness falls, Anna lights the candles in the Christmas wreath, which looks so beautiful on the large dining table. The nieces' and nephew's eyes shine expectantly in the glow of the light: "It is not long until Christmas now," say the dear little ones.
Start by making the pins you will need to secure moss, spruce, and decorations. The pins are made by cutting the iron wires into shorter pieces with a pair of wire cutters and then bending each piece in the middle.
Cover the straw ring with moss, and add a bit of spruce in between. Secure as you go by pinning the needles into the wreath, as shown in the video.
When the wreath is completely covered, the four candleholders are attached to it. Once the candleholders are positioned as desired, insert four candles in your preferred colour.
Cones, dried oranges, or other decorations can also be attached to the wreath by wrapping iron wire around them, as shown in the video. Then, cut the floristry wire with the wire cutters and attach the cone or orange to the wreath.
Your Christmas wreath is now complete and ready to bring joy during the wonderful festive season.
